GeForce GTX 1660 vs RTX A2000 specs and performance

According to the hardwareDB Benchmark, the RTX A2000 GPU is faster than the GeForce GTX 1660 in gaming.

In our comparison, the GeForce GTX 1660 has a significantly higher core clock speed. This is the frequency at which the graphics core is running at. While not necessarily an indicator of overall performance, this metric can be useful when comparing two GPUs based on the same architecture. In addition, the GeForce GTX 1660 also has a significantly higher boost clock speed: the maximum frequency the chip can reach if power delivery and thermals allow.

In addition, the RTX A2000 has a significantly lower TDP at 70 W when compared to the GeForce GTX 1660 at 120 W. This is not a measure of performance, but rather the amount of heat generated by the chip when running at its highest speed.

In conclusion, all specs and GPU benchmarks considered, will recommend the RTX A2000 over the GeForce GTX 1660.
